Overview
The utilization of recyclable materials in beverage lines refers to the incorporation of environmentally-friendly materials in the production and packaging of beverages. This includes materials that can be easily recycled or repurposed, contributing to a circular economy and reducing the carbon footprint of the beverage industry.

Types of Recyclable Materials
Several types of recyclable materials are commonly used in beverage lines, including:
- Recycled PET (rPET): Repurposed plastic commonly used in beverage bottles.
- Aluminum: Infinitely recyclable material suitable for cans and bottles.
- Glass: Highly recyclable and preserving the taste of beverages.
- Paperboard: Sustainable option for cartons and packaging.
